Output 2599057324faa56661b530a9ae8974aa042521b0ec48bfda45a396698e1af6f4:18

value
50000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fd30ebf7021a84db5124c031bb321b3cdc4f56b7 OP_EQUALVERIFY OP_CHECKSIG
address
1Q5kZg9oJQaNSqiY2jqhDKAFZTtRcab5hD
transaction
2599057324faa56661b530a9ae8974aa042521b0ec48bfda45a396698e1af6f4
spent
true